This combination will result in blue or splash offspringSilkie chickens blue breeding chart:Blue X Blue = 50% Blue, 25% Black , 25% SplashBlue X Splash = 50% Blue , 50% SplashBlue X Black = 50% Blue, 50% BlackBlack X Black = 100% BlackSplash X Black = 100% BlueSplash X Splash = 100% Splash. When a barred male, (B, B) is crossed with a non-barred female, (b+, _), all the chicks will be barred. The underscore indicates her short chromosome lacks the location of that gene.When a barred female (B,_) is crossed with a non-barred male, (b+, b+) results in all the male offspring being barred and the females are non-barred.
